> > > Hi Randal,
> > >
> > > You need to use the PostGresV2 client.  You can find it at:
> > > http://www.squeaksource.com/PostgresV2.html
> > >
> > > You should also load the cryptography package at:
> > >
> > > http://www.squeaksource.com/Cryptography.html
> > >
> > > to support MD5, which works fine.
> > >
> > > Also consider using Glorp:
> > > http://www.squeaksource.com/Glorp.html
> > >
> > > to map your Objects to the relational database.

> > > > I'm working on a project that requires access to a postgresql
> > database.
> > > >
> > > > The postgres client in Squeakmap seems to fail if md5
> password auth is
> > > > enabled
> > > > (or at least that's my best guess so far about why it works on my
> > laptop
> > > > and
> > > > not the server).
> > > >
> > > > I googled for "postgres squeak" and found Jim-Postgresql's
> > > client, but it
> > > > hangs in my 3.10 image when trying to connect. And by hang, I mean
> > > > command-period does nothing, and I have to force quit.
> > > >
> > > > Does anyone have a working pg client that works with modern
> squeak and
> > > > modern
> > > > postgresql?
